Festive concert date at Tabernacle

-

A TRADITIONA­L festive concert will be taking place in Morriston on Saturday.

Tickets are available for the Christmas 2018 celebratio­n of Handel’s Messiah, which will take place at Tabernacle Chapel, Morriston.

Tabernacle Morriston Choir, along with choristers from the Cardiff Bach Choir, will combine to perform Handel’s much-loved work, which, following a 10-year absence, was reintroduc­ed by the choir as a special annual Christmas event at Tabernacle Chapel three years ago.

The musical accompanim­ent will feature the famous Tabernacle Chapel organ, played by Glenn Crooks, with harpsichor­d accompanim­ent provided by Sally Tarleton.

Soloists will be Ros Evans, soprano; Sian Menna, contralto; Gareth Morris, tenor; and Martin Lloyd, bass.

The concert will be under the baton of Luke Spencer, musical director of both Tabernacle Morriston and Cardiff Bach Choir.
